Crossings (Cantonese Version)
Simon Yam, Anita Yuen

Tai Seng, 2006

A romantic thriller about a young H.K. woman who travels to New York to visit her photographer boyfriend. She has no idea that her boyfriend is not a photographer, but a gangster & that the package he has asked her to deliver is fill with heroin.
